The story of Mary Frances Craft began in 1933 in McComb, Pike, Mississippi, USA. Mary Frances Craft married David Allen Dawson Jr, and had children including David Allen Dawson Iii, Leslie Harriman Dawson, Vicky Lorraine Dawson. Mary Frances Craft passed away in 2017 in Summit, Pike County, Mississippi, United States of America.
